Current Setting
The Current Setting group box contains a status message indicating which print quality setting is
currently in use. When you make a change in the Print Quality Details dialog box, the setting
changes from This is the "Faster Printing" setting (or This is the “Best Quality” setting) to This
is a "Custom" setting.
Output Settings
The Output Settings group box contains controls for resolution and pattern scaling, and to print all
text as black.
The following are the default values for the Output Settings:
■ Resolution: FastRes 1200 is selected
■ Resolution Enhancement Technology (REt) is On
■ Scale Patterns (WYSIWYG) is selected
■ Print all Text as Black is not selected
Resolution
Resolution refers to the number of dots per inch (dpi) used to print the page. As resolution is
increased, the quality (clarity and visual appeal) of print on the page is improved. However, higher
resolution can also result in longer printing times. The following resolution options are available for
the HP LaserJet 4250/4350 printers:
■ ProRes 1200 (180 lpi): Prints using a resolution of 1200 x 1200 with 180 lines per inch (lpi). This
prints slower than other resolutions, but has the best print quality.
■ ProRes 1200 (141 lpi): Prints using a resolution of 1200 x 1200 with 141 lines per inch (lpi). It
prints slower than other resolutions, but has the best print quality.
■ FastRes 1200: Prints using a resolution of 1200 x 600. It is faster than full 1200 x 1200
resolution, but has a slightly lower print quality.
■ 600 dpi: Prints using standard 600 dpi resolution.
Resolution Enhancement technology (REt)
REt refines the print quality of characters by smoothing out jagged edges that can occur on the
angles and curves of a printed image. It is On by default. Select Off if graphics, particularly scanned
images, are not printing clearly.
